The 3 months correlation between Thyssenkrupp and Lloyds is 0.89.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Thyssenkrupp AG ON and Lloyds Banking Group in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Lloyds Banking Group and Thyssenkrupp is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Thyssenkrupp AG ON are associated (or correlated) with Lloyds Banking. The main advantage of trading using opposite Thyssenkrupp and Lloyds Banking posit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Thyssenkrupp position performs unexpectedly, Lloyds Banking can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
